Subject: Re: [PATCH] vfio-pci/nvlink2: Fix potential VMA leak

> On Mon, May 06, 2019 at 03:58:45PM -0600, Alex Williamson wrote:
> > On Fri, 19 Apr 2019 17:37:17 +0200
> > Greg Kurz <groug@kaod.org> wrote:
> >
> > > If vfio_pci_register_dev_region() fails then we should rollback
> > > previous changes, ie. unmap the ATSD registers.
> > >
> > > Signed-off-by: Greg Kurz <groug@kaod.org>
> > > ---
> >
> > Applied to vfio next branch for v5.2 with Alexey's R-b. Thanks!
> >
> > Alex
>
> Should this have a fixes tag? e.g.:
> Fixes: 7f92891778df ("vfio_pci: Add NVIDIA GV100GL [Tesla V100 SXM2] subdriver")
>
Oops... you're right.
Alex, can you add the above tag ?
> > > drivers/vfio/pci/vfio_pci_nvlink2.c | 2 ++
> > > 1 file changed, 2 insertions(+)
> > >
> > > diff --git a/drivers/vfio/pci/vfio_pci_nvlink2.c b/drivers/vfio/pci/vfio_pci_nvlink2.c
> > > index 32f695ffe128..50fe3c4f7feb 100644
> > > --- a/drivers/vfio/pci/vfio_pci_nvlink2.c
> > > +++ b/drivers/vfio/pci/vfio_pci_nvlink2.c
> > > @@ -472,6 +472,8 @@ int vfio_pci_ibm_npu2_init(struct vfio_pci_device *vdev)
> > > return 0;
> > >
> > > free_exit:
> > > + if (data->base)
> > > + memunmap(data->base);
> > > kfree(data);
> > >
> > > return ret;
> > >
